About the role
- Develop and expand DICK’S Sporting Goods Revit/BIM Program enabling improvements in store design, coordination, consistency, and communication
- Build and maintain all Revit/BIM program templates and models ensuring content, schedules, and outputs meet stakeholders’ information requirements
- Establish communication channels with all internal and external stakeholders leading to iterative improvements in the BIM program
- Develop and document BIM best practices, processes, and standards
- Oversee the accurate utilization of BIM standards and protocols by program stakeholders
- Continuously improve the Revit/BIM ecosystem of technologies ensuring the effective transfer of information and collaboration
- Lead internal/external stakeholders and the DSG IT department in creating the BIM strategy, roadmap for future enhancements, systems integrations and updates
- Maintain a high-level of knowledge about advances in BIM technology cascade the information across the department
- Evaluate and implement BIM-related technology enhancements and improvements
- Develop documentation to support the rollout of updates and innovations in technology and system functionality
- Troubleshoot software issues and provide guidance on hardware requirements that result in efficient and sustainable solutions
- Provide subject matter expertise and support of Revit/BIM-ecosystem related software applications such as Revit, Enscape, Navisworks, Sketchup, and ACC
- Develop and manage a QAQC program ensuring the accuracy and compliance with company BIM standards
- Maintain an up-to-date catalog of families, models, and prototype templates for consistency across teammates and projects
- Deliver comprehensive end-user training
- Provide system onboarding support for new teammates
Requirements
- Bachelor's Degree in Architecture, Construction Management, Engineering or other relevant degree / experience
- 7-10 years of experience as a BIM Manager or in a similar technical and process-specific role
- Proficient with Dynamo scripts and coding
- Experience utilizing Microsoft & Autodesk Suite
- Experience working with Navisworks
- Excellent AutoCAD and Revit skills
- Experience utilizing Enscape
- Experience using Clash Detection software applications
